  5. Mulgrew set to join Sheffield United Published: 12/06/2010 ABERDEEN defender Charlie Mulgrew is expected to seal his departure from Pittodrie next week when he signs for Sheffield United. The former Scotland under-21 international has verbally agreed a three-year deal with the English Championship club and will complete the formalities upon his return from holiday in Turkey. Mulgrew, who joined the Dons from Wolves two years ago, has offers from other clubs in England, Brentford and Huddersfield, as well as Portuguese club Maritimo, but has decided to link-up with Blades manager Kevin Blackwell following the offer of a three-year contract. Blackwell said: “He is a player we are interested in but it is at a delicate stage. “He has been on our radar for a while, although his agent is talking to other clubs.” Aberdeen have added another fixture to their pre-season campaign. The Dons will head to Glebe Park to face Brechin City in the David Will memorial match on Tuesday, August 3 (kick-off 7.45pm). Mark McGhee’s men face Fraserburgh, Peterhead and Dunfermline before heading for a week in England from July 23 where they will play against Tamworth, Port Vale and Brighton and Hove Albion. They return to the north-east ahead of the Scottish Premier League kick off on August 14.
